What Does This Urine Culture Test Report Indicate?

Sir my wife is 2.5 month pregnant woman. Recently she had a small pain in her lower abdominal.. My doctor advice me to go through urine culture test. Pus cells were found in the urine. And other observation of urine culture test is GRAM STAIN:- GRAM NEGATIVE BACILLI ORGANISUM:- Gram negative bacilli ( E.coli) grown after 48 hrs incubation COLONY COUNT:- MORE THAN 1Lac Col/Cu mm Please give me some advice is it critical for baby. Doctor prescribed medicine:- 1.     Urosol ( Di Sodium hydrogen citrate & potassium citrate solution ) 2.     Zifi LBX + 200( Cefixime, Dicloxacilin ( MR) & Lactic Acid Bacilus ) Please help

General & Family Physician 's  Response
Hello,

I read carefully your query and understand your concern.

The symptoms seem to be related to a urinary tract infection.

I see that you have already taken the treatment.

I agree with the treatment and I suggest you to follow it as prescribed by your doctor.

I recommend to drink liquids and retest after the treatment.
